What is the origin and characteristics of the Acer?

The red maple, as it is known in popular language, is a tree that grows naturally from Canada to Mexico. It grows around 20 and 30 meters, although in habitat it can reach 40 meters. Their life expectancy is 100-200 years, provided the right conditions are met.

Its leaves are palmate, green, and have 3-5 lobes with irregularly toothed margins.. They measure about 5 to 10 centimeters, and are opposite. With the fall in temperatures in autumn, they turn reddish before falling.

The flowers are male or female, and may appear on separate specimens when the trees are young, or on the same one in late winter or early spring. The former are composed of 5 petals and sepals that appear in groups; and the second ones are just yellow stamens.

The fruit is a disamara (double samara) reddish, brownish or yellow, measuring between 15 and 25 millimeters long. Ripens in late spring or early summer.

What uses is it given?

The red maple is a splendid tree to plant in a garden. Not only because it gets beautiful in the fall, but also because of the shade it provides. In addition, you will be able to plant other plants under it, since you will not have problems with its roots (which would happen if you wanted to plant something under a fig, pine or eucalyptus tree).

Numerous cultivars have been created, such as:

  • october glory
  • Red Sunset
  • fireburst
  • Florida Flame
  • Gulf Ember

These last three are especially interesting for warm-temperate climates, since they better withstand heat.

However, apart from being used as an ornamental, it is also one of the maples whose sap is extracted to produce maple syrup, although they say that it tastes less sweet than that of the maple. Acer.

What care should be given to Acer?

The red maple adapts to a wide range of conditions, being able to grow in climates with strong or light frosts, and with mild temperatures throughout the year. Even tolerates a wide variety of soils, although in alkaline soils it is common to have chlorosis due to lack of iron.

But what you do need is be planted outside, since it would not survive long inside the house. Also, due to its size, it is not a good idea to always grow it in a pot, unless it is used as a bonsai.

If we talk about irrigation, it is highly recommended to water it more or less frequently in summer, especially if it is especially hot and dry. It should also be fertilized in spring and summer, with any fertilizer of organic origin, such as compost.

The roots, as we have mentioned before, are not very invasive. Now, that does not mean that it can be planted a few centimeters from the wall. In order for it to grow properly, I do not advise planting it less than 5 meters from other trees or pipes.

It resists temperatures down to -18ºC.
